Denco Posted June 20, 2014 Posted June 20, 2014 (edited) Hi, I'm having this strange issue that started appearing at version 1.2.8. After while of playing ( around 5 to 10 minutes ) my game freezes. I can hear the sound still playing in the background but the game is dead. Whats even stranger is that I have to restart my computer afterwards because it's freezing. To close the game it takes quite amount of willpower and time because the whole system is freezing. It freezes every 1 sec for at least 20 seconds. The last time I played DCS World is at version 1.2.7 and the only thing changed is my graphics card and DCS BS2 which I bought today. Anyone experiencing these difficulties? docfu Posted June 20, 2014 Posted June 20, 2014 Either it's a graphics card driver problem or your new card is overheating and rebooting (but your system is staying alive, without video.) Are you overclocking your graphics card or did you mess with the default fan settings? I found nVidia's new drivers turn off the fans when the card is under a certain temperature, and only engage them after the card is in danger of overheating. Try cranking up your fan speeds to 50%, 75% or 100% then do another run of the game.

SkateZilla Posted June 20, 2014 Posted June 20, 2014 Going by the issue, it sounds like the GPU itself is shutting off. Max Temp for 780ti is 95°C, Max. So either it is overheating, or your power supply can't feed the card the power it needs. Check you event viewer for any Yellow/Red Icons as well. Denco Posted June 20, 2014 Author Posted June 20, 2014 After deleting the DCS folder inside save games the problem seems to be fixed. I need to verify it more but I made it to the end of the BS2 tutorial without the game freezing. ENO Posted June 21, 2014 Posted June 21, 2014 Glad you're back in action. Makes me wonder if that was the same saved games folder from Steam... if so that certainly explains the issue since it would have maintained settings from your other card. Inevitably I expect that would have caused trouble. Either way... for whatever reason it worked so enjoy! "ENO" Type in anger and you will make the greatest post you will ever regret.
